Keep sponging on more as needed so the concrete stays wet for ... Web8 mei 2002 · Method 1. Apply VanGo and leave on till the stain disappears, then wash off. This method does not require neutralising. If a white residue appears simply hose this off. Method 2. Oxcid can be applied to the stained bricks without pre-wetting. This should be neutralised with a neutralising agent such as Neutril. Do not wash off.

Web26 nov. 2024 · Use a hose to wash off dirt and debris. Turn your garden hose on full spray and wash any dirt and grime off the brick as best you can with the strong force of the hose spray. Work methodically from one side to the other so that it doesn’t keep spraying back onto a part you have already cleaned.
